A qualified healthcare professional must conduct a thorough interview and background check prior to diagnosing ADHD in adults. This is a complicated and challenging process, which is why it should not be attempted to rush. NICE guidelines say that psychiatrists who are registered in the UK or a specialist ADHD Nurse can only make a psychiatric evaluation for ADHD.

There is a shortage of ADHD assessors in the NHS, which can result in lengthy waiting times. If you're registered with a GP in England, you have the option of choosing your own ADHD assessor. This is known as the 'Right to Choose' route. These independent providers typically have shorter waiting times than the NHS. Additionally, some of them offer appointments online via video call. This allows those with mobility issues or other issues to receive an ADHD assessment.

ADHD is one of the neurodevelopmental disorders defined in the DSM5 manual of mental health diagnosis. It's a behavioural condition that is characterised by inattentiveness and hyperactivity/impulsivity. These symptoms must be uncharacteristic for your developmental age and can be observed in more than one setting (eg at home, at work and at school). These symptoms should last for longer than six months and interfere negatively with your social, academic, and professional performance.

You are able to be assessed for ADHD by psychologists if you are in school. The results of the assessment can be used to support your claim for reasonable adjustments and Disabled Student" Allowance. This is particularly useful for students suffering from ADHD who need additional support at the university level.

If you have ADHD as an adult, it is crucial to obtain a full diagnosis and discuss treatment options. This assessment should be performed by a psychiatrist, or a mental health specialist nurse. They are the only healthcare professionals in the UK who are certified to diagnose ADHD. The test is typically an interview lasting between 45 and 90 minutes with psychiatrists. It should include your medical history, family background and other factors that can affect ADHD symptoms.

In addition to evaluating your symptoms, the psychiatrist will likely want to rule out other illnesses that may be mistaken for ADHD like thyroid, anxiety, depression or issues. They will also look over your family history and school records. The process could take some time but the wait is worth it.

If you are a patient of a doctor you can select the psychiatrist to examine your ADHD using your Right to Choice. You can ask your doctor for a referral to a private service that has shared care agreements (which means you only pay the NHS prescription fee) together with the NHS. These providers offer shorter waiting times than the NHS and a majority of them provide appointments via video chat.
